Robert D. Martin 72 of New Bedford passed away at home, surrounded by his loving family, of pancreatic cancer, on Sunday February 5, 2012. He was the son of the late Charles S. and Helen (Gillis) Martin. He was born in Ridgewood, NY on May 29, 1939. He served in the United States Navy from August 1956 thru March 1960 as a Quartermaster on the U.S.S.Forest Royal and from March 1960 thru August 1962 in the U.S. Naval reserves where he was honorably discharged. Mr. Martin was a commercial and industrial metal building contractor for over 40 years and constructed many of the buildings you see in the north and south terminals in New Bedford, today. He was a life member of the Elks and a former member of the 6 th Bristol club. His greatest joy was spending time with his family and the many trips they took together. He is survived by his wife of 48 years Pauline (Kalles), his daughter Donna Medeiros and her husband Paul, his granddaughters Jennifer Pezzatti and Amy Medeiros, his great-granddaughters Mya Rae Medeiros and Makenna Joy Pezzatti all of New Bedford. His brothers Charles Martin and his partner Maria of New Bedford, Donald Martin and his partner Sharon of Martha’s Vineyard. He is pre deceased by his son Gary Scott Martin and his brother Thomas Martin. His visiting hours are Tuesday 4-8pm with a funeral service at 5pm. At his request he will be cremated and the burial of his cremains will be private. In lieu of flowers donations in his memory may be made to the American Cancer Society, earmarked for pancreatic cancer research.
